The Three-Step Standard: What Reputable Salons *Actually* Do
Contrary to viral TikTok hacks promising ‘5-minute gel removal,’ licensed nail technicians follow a tightly regulated, three-phase protocol grounded in keratin biology and cosmetic chemistry. Let’s break down each phase—not as theory, but as practiced daily by award-winning salons like The Nail Lab (Chicago) and Lumina Nails (Austin), both certified by the National Association of Cosmetology Boards (NACB).
Phase 1: Controlled Surface Preparation
This isn’t about ‘roughing up’ your nail—it’s about creating micro-porosity *only* where needed. Using a 180-grit buffer (never a drill or coarse file), technicians gently de-gloss the top coat surface for 8–12 seconds per nail. Why so precise? A 2022 study in the International Journal of Cosmetic Science found that exceeding 15 seconds of buffering increased keratin fiber fragmentation by 40%, directly correlating with post-removal peeling and brittleness. The goal: disrupt the polymerized top layer just enough to allow acetone penetration—without compromising the underlying nail plate.
Phase 2: Acetone Immersion—Not Dabbing, Not Wiping
Here’s where most at-home attempts fail—and where salon expertise shines. Licensed technicians use medical-grade, anhydrous (99.5% pure) acetone—not drugstore ‘acetone blends’ containing oils or fragrances that slow evaporation and increase soak time. Each finger is individually wrapped in lint-free cotton soaked in acetone, then sealed with aluminum foil—not plastic wrap—to create a low-pressure, high-humidity microenvironment. This accelerates solvent diffusion into the gel matrix without evaporative cooling or oxygen interference. According to Dr. Lena Cho, board-certified dermatologist and co-author of the American Academy of Dermatology’s Nail Health Guidelines, “Foiling creates optimal thermodynamic conditions for controlled polymer breakdown—cutting soak time from 25+ minutes to 12–15 minutes while reducing keratin dehydration by 63%.”
Phase 3: Gentle Lift-and-Peal—Never Scraping
After timed immersion, the foil is removed, and the softened gel is *lifted* using a wooden cuticle stick—never metal tools or aggressive pushing. Technicians apply light, radial pressure from the cuticle toward the free edge, allowing the dissolved polymer to separate cleanly from the nail bed. If resistance is felt, they re-wrap for 2–3 more minutes rather than forcing separation. This distinction matters: scraping shears keratin layers; lifting preserves them. At The Nail Lab, technicians undergo biannual competency testing on this step—pass/fail based on nail plate integrity scans using reflectance confocal microscopy.
What Happens When Things Go Wrong (And How to Spot Red Flags)
Not all salons adhere to best practices—and many don’t realize the long-term consequences. Consider Maria, a 34-year-old graphic designer who visited three different salons over six months for weekly gel manicures. By month four, her thumbnails were splitting vertically and developed a permanent white banding pattern. A dermoscopic exam revealed subclinical onycholysis and keratinocyte apoptosis—both linked to repeated mechanical trauma and acetone overexposure. Her case mirrors findings in a 2023 University of California, San Francisco nail health cohort study: 61% of participants with chronic nail thinning had undergone ≥2 gel removals per month using unregulated techniques.
Red flags to watch for during your next appointment:
- Drill use for removal — Even low-speed drills abrade the nail plate at a cellular level; banned by the California Board of Barbering and Cosmetology since 2022.
- No foil wrapping — Dabbing or ‘acetone-soaked pads held in place’ increases evaporation, requiring longer exposure and greater solvent absorption into the nail bed.
- ‘Peel-off’ claims — True peel-off gels contain photoinitiators that degrade under UV light—but most salons don’t use UV lamps for removal, making this claim scientifically invalid.
- No post-removal conditioning — Skipping cuticle oil application within 5 minutes of removal leaves nails vulnerable to transepidermal water loss (TEWL), accelerating dryness and micro-cracking.
The Ingredient Truth: Why ‘Acetone-Free’ Removers Are Often Worse
A growing number of salons now advertise ‘gentle, acetone-free gel removers.’ Sounds ideal—until you examine the chemistry. Most rely on ethyl acetate, propylene carbonate, or dibasic esters. While less volatile, these solvents require significantly longer dwell times (up to 35 minutes) and penetrate deeper into the nail plate due to lower polarity. A 2024 comparative analysis in Cosmetic Science & Technology found that ethyl acetate-based removers caused 2.3× more nail plate swelling and delayed keratin recovery by 48 hours versus pharmaceutical-grade acetone. As cosmetic chemist Dr. Arjun Patel (former R&D lead at OPI) explains: “Acetone isn’t harsh—it’s precise. Its small molecular size allows targeted dissolution of methacrylate polymers without disrupting nail lipids. Substitutes are slower, less selective, and more disruptive to the nail’s natural barrier.”

Frequently Asked Questions
Can I safely remove gel polish at home if I follow salon steps?
Yes—but only with strict adherence to professional standards. You’ll need USP-grade acetone (not drugstore blend), lint-free cotton, aluminum foil, a 180-grit buffer, and a timer. Crucially, you must stop immediately if you feel heat, stinging, or resistance during lifting. Home removal carries ~3.2× higher risk of microtrauma, per the 2024 AAD Home Beauty Safety Survey. If you have thin, brittle, or medically compromised nails (e.g., psoriasis, eczema), consult a dermatologist first.
Does gel polish removal cause nail fungus?
No—gel polish itself doesn’t cause fungal infection. However, improper removal that damages the nail plate or cuticle creates entry points for dermatophytes. A 2023 study in Mycoses found that clients with recurrent onychomycosis were 4.7× more likely to report frequent aggressive filing or prolonged acetone exposure during removal. Healthy nails with intact barriers resist colonization—even in high-moisture environments.
How often can I get gel manicures without damaging my nails?
Dermatologists recommend a minimum 2–3 week rest period between applications. During rest, use a nourishing base coat with hydrolyzed keratin and panthenol, and avoid polish entirely for at least one cycle. The nail plate regenerates fully every 6–8 weeks—but repeated chemical exposure before full recovery leads to cumulative structural fatigue. Think of it like muscle recovery: you wouldn’t lift heavy weights daily without rest—your nails need the same respect.
Do LED vs. UV lamps affect removal difficulty?
No—lamp type affects curing speed and depth, not polymer stability. Both LED-cured and UV-cured gels use similar methacrylate monomers and cross-linkers. Removal efficacy depends solely on solvent access and soak time—not lamp wavelength. Claims that ‘LED gels come off easier’ are marketing myths unsupported by polymer science or clinical testing.
Is soaking fingers in acetone dangerous for my skin?
Short, controlled exposure (12–15 min) with foil barrier poses minimal risk to healthy skin. However, prolonged or repeated contact causes epidermal barrier disruption, especially on cuticles and lateral nail folds. Always wear nitrile gloves when handling acetone, and apply barrier cream (containing dimethicone and ceramides) to exposed skin pre-soak. Never soak bare hands—only fingertips wrapped in cotton/foil.
Common Myths Debunked
- Myth #1: “Soaking longer makes removal easier.” — False. Beyond 15 minutes, acetone begins dissolving intercellular lipids in the nail plate, increasing porosity and weakening tensile strength. Research shows nails soaked >20 minutes lose 29% of their bending modulus—their ability to flex without breaking.
- Myth #2: “Oil-based removers are safer for nails.” — Misleading. Oils (like soy or almond) slow acetone evaporation, extending exposure time and increasing solvent absorption. They also leave residue that interferes with subsequent polish adhesion—leading technicians to over-buff next time, creating a damaging cycle.
